libelf: abolish obsolete macros
Abolish ELF_PTRVAL_[CONST_]{CHAR,VOID}; change uses to elf_ptrval. Abolish ELF_HANDLE_DECL_NONCONST; change uses to ELF_HANDLE_DECL. Abolish ELF_OBSOLETE_VOIDP_CAST; simply remove all uses. No functional change. (Verified by diffing assembler output.) This is part of the fix to a security issue, XSA-55.
